How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Glen Rock?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Glen Rock Studio Apartments | $2,218 | $1,550 | $2,709 |
| Glen Rock 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,339 | $1,600 | $3,585 |
| Glen Rock 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,962 | $1,700 | $4,770 |
| Glen Rock 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,504 | $2,300 | $5,320 |
| Glen Rock 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,550 | $3,500 | $3,600 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Glen Rock Apartments with Laundry Rooms
How much is the average rent for Glen Rock Apartments with Laundry Rooms?
The average rent for a Apartment in Glen Rock with Laundry Rooms is $1,925.
What is the largest Glen Rock Apartment for rent with Laundry Rooms?
Today's Apartment with Laundry Rooms and the most square footage in Glen Rock is a 1,015 square feet unit starting from $1,750 at Kent Village.
What is the average size for Glen Rock Apartments for rent with Laundry Rooms?
The average size for a rental with Laundry Rooms in Glen Rock is currently at 692 sq ft.
